Determination of temperature dependence of thermophysical parameters in solids: numerical solution of the problem

Abstract: Two approaches one presented to determine the thermophysical properties of materials. Necessary experimental data on thermal curves have been extracted by simulation modeling of the heat propagation process based on numerically solving the 1D thermal conductivity equation. The thermal conductivity and thermal diffusivity coefficients have been calculated independently using a method suggested in this study. Comparing our results with data from simulation modeling makes it possible to estimate the calculation accuracy. The suggested method provides a better qualitative and quantitative insight into the thermophysical properties of materials.
